- trenchancy as a noun:
- 1
trenchancy
noun
1 trenchancy
Keenness and forcefulness of thought or expression or intellect.
synonym: incisiveness.
debug info: 0.0273
noun
Keenness and forcefulness of thought or expression or intellect.
synonym: incisiveness.
debug info: 0.0273